The Registration Process: What to Expect
The first step in joining an online casino is, of course, registration. While the specific details may vary slightly between platforms, the core requirements remain consistent. Typically, you’ll be asked to provide basic personal information, including your full name, date of birth, address, and email address. You’ll also need to create a unique username and password. Be meticulous when entering this information, as any discrepancies can cause issues later on during the verification stage. Many casinos also ask you to select your preferred currency (usually EUR for Irish players) and to agree to the terms and conditions. Take the time to read these terms; they contain vital information about bonuses, wagering requirements, and withdrawal policies. Some casinos may also offer the option to set deposit limits or self-exclusion periods during registration, which are valuable tools for responsible gambling. Finally, you might be asked to provide a mobile phone number for account verification via SMS.
Choosing a Strong Password and Protecting Your Account
Security starts with a strong password. Avoid using easily guessable information like your birthdate or pet’s name. Instead, create a complex password that includes a combination of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Consider using a password manager to securely store your credentials. Regularly change your password and never share it with anyone. Enable two-factor authentication (2FA) if the casino offers it. This adds an extra layer of security by requiring a verification code from your phone or email whenever you log in. Be wary of phishing attempts – never click on links in emails or messages from unknown senders, and always access the casino’s website directly through your browser.
The Verification Process: Proving Your Identity
Verification is where the rubber meets the road. This process is mandated by regulatory bodies like the Irish Revenue Commissioners and the Gambling Regulatory Authority of Ireland to ensure compliance with anti-money laundering (AML) and know-your-customer (KYC) regulations. It’s designed to protect both the casino and its players. This usually involves submitting documentation to prove your identity, age, and address. The specific documents required can vary, but common examples include:
- Proof of Identity: A copy of your passport, driver’s license, or national identity card. Ensure the document is clear, legible, and shows your photo, full name, and date of birth.
- Proof of Address: A recent utility bill (electricity, gas, water), bank statement, or official letter from a government agency. The document must be dated within the last three to six months and display your full name and current address.
- Proof of Payment Method: If you’re using a credit card, you might be asked to provide a copy of the card (obscuring the middle digits and the CVV code for security). For e-wallets or bank transfers, you might need to provide screenshots of your account details.
Common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them
Delays in verification are a common source of frustration for online gamblers. To avoid these, ensure that all documents are clear, complete, and up-to-date. Make sure the information on your documents matches the details you provided during registration. Submit high-quality scans or photos; blurry or unreadable documents will be rejected. Respond promptly to any requests from the casino for additional information. Some casinos may also conduct additional verification checks, such as phone calls or video verification, so be prepared to cooperate. Finally, be patient. Verification can sometimes take a few days, especially during peak times.
Understanding the Implications of Verification
Completing the verification process unlocks several benefits. It allows you to make withdrawals, claim bonuses, and participate in all the casino’s features. It also demonstrates your commitment to responsible gambling. Verified accounts are generally considered more trustworthy, which can lead to a more positive gaming experience. Failure to verify your account can result in restrictions, including the inability to deposit funds, place bets, or withdraw winnings. In severe cases, the casino may close your account and seize any remaining funds. The verification process also protects you. By verifying your identity, you prevent unauthorized access to your account and reduce the risk of fraud. It ensures that your winnings are paid to the correct person and that your personal information is protected.
